The Government's being urged to address the controversial issue of funding for Devon's schools.
Every child in a Devon school gets £644 less in Government funding than the national average ...according to the latest figures.
The county currently stands sixth from the bottom of a table of 50 local authorities, for the amount of money received to educate the county's children
The county council's cabinet member for education in Devon is meeting the Education Minister soon, to raise the issue.
